* Restructure high-level nacl.pwhash into a package * Adapt argon2{i,id} tests to the restructured API Temporarily duplicate scrypt tests * Add c-level bindings for strprefix * Add previously overlooked password hasher properties * Expose the previously missing hasher properties: - STRPREFIX - PWHASH_SIZE - PASSWD_{MIN,MAX} - MEMLIMIT_{MIN,MAX} - OPSLIMIT_{MIN,MAX} in pwhash high level hasher implementation modules * Add {MEMLIMIT,OPSLIMIT}_MODERATE constants to scrypt They are both set as being the geometric means of the corresponding _INTERACTIVE and _SENSITIVE limits * Update pwhash.* modules docstrings. * Add generic password hash verifier * Add tests for generic password hash verifier * Update password hashing docs to the new API * Remove the kdf() raw password hasher from top level since it only does make sense at the individual construct level. Also rename argon2 to _argon2, since it is not meant for api level export * Adapt tests to use the exposed implementation of argon2{i,id} verifier * Add API level documentation for nacl.pwhash

nacl.pwhash | ||
=========== | ||
|
||
.. module:: nacl.pwhash | ||
|
||
The package pwhash provides implementations of modern *memory-hard* | ||
password hashing construction exposing modules with a uniform API. | ||
|
||
Functions exposed at top level | ||
------------------------------ | ||
|
||
The top level module only provides the functions implementing | ||
ascii encoded hashing and verification. | ||
|
||
.. function:: str(password, \ | ||
opslimit=OPSLIMIT_INTERACTIVE, \ | ||
memlimit=MEMLIMIT_INTERACTIVE) | ||
|
||
Returns a password verifier hash, generated with the password hasher | ||
choosen as a default by libsodium. | ||
|
||
:param password: password used to seed the key derivation procedure; | ||
it length must be between | ||
:py:const:`PASSWD_MIN` and | ||
:py:const:`PASSWD_MAX` | ||
:type password: bytes | ||
:param opslimit: the time component (operation count) | ||
of the key derivation procedure's computational cost; | ||
it must be between | ||
:py:const:`OPSLIMIT_MIN` and | ||
:py:const:`OPSLIMIT_MAX` | ||
:type opslimit: int | ||
:param memlimit: the memory occupation component | ||
of the key derivation procedure's computational cost; | ||
it must be between | ||
:py:const:`MEMLIMIT_MIN` and | ||
:py:const:`MEMLIMIT_MAX` | ||
:type memlimit: int | ||
:returns: the ascii encoded password hash along with a prefix encoding | ||
the used hashing construct, the random generated salt and | ||
the operation and memory limits used to generate the password hash | ||
:rtype: bytes | ||
|
||
|
||
As of PyNaCl version 1.2 this is :py:func:`nacl.pwhash.argon2id.str`. | ||
|
||
.. versionadded:: 1.2 | ||
|
||
|
||
.. function:: verify(password_hash, password) | ||
|
||
This function checks if hashing the proposed password, with | ||
the same construction and parameters encoded in the password hash | ||
would generate the same encoded string, thus verifying the | ||
correct password has been proposed in an authentication attempt. | ||
|
||
.. versionadded:: 1.2 | ||
|
||
.. rubric:: Module level constants | ||
|
||
The top level module defines the constants related to the :py:func:`str` | ||
hashing construct and its corresponding :py:func:`verify` password | ||
verifier. | ||
|
||
.. py:data:: PASSWD_MIN | ||
.. py:data:: PASSWD_MAX | ||
minimum and maximum length of the password to hash | ||
|
||
.. py:data:: PWHASH_SIZE | ||
maximum size of the encoded hash | ||
|
||
.. py:data:: OPSLIMIT_MIN | ||
.. py:data:: OPSLIMIT_MAX | ||
minimum and maximum operation count for the hashing construct | ||
|
||
.. py:data:: MEMLIMIT_MIN | ||
.. py:data:: MEMLIMIT_MAX | ||
minimum and maximum memory occupation for the hashing construct | ||
|
||
and the recommended values for the opslimit and memlimit parameters | ||
|
||
.. py:data:: MEMLIMIT_INTERACTIVE | ||
.. py:data:: OPSLIMIT_INTERACTIVE | ||
recommended values for the interactive user authentication password | ||
check case, leading to a sub-second hashing time | ||
|
||
.. py:data:: MEMLIMIT_SENSITIVE | ||
.. py:data:: OPSLIMIT_SENSITIVE | ||
recommended values for generating a password hash/derived key meant to protect | ||
sensitive data, leading to a multi-second hashing time | ||
|
||
.. py:data:: MEMLIMIT_MODERATE | ||
.. py:data:: OPSLIMIT_MODERATE | ||
values leading to a hashing time and memory cost intermediate between the | ||
interactive and the sensitive cases | ||
|
||
Per-mechanism password hashing implementation modules | ||
----------------------------------------------------- | ||
|
||
Along with the respective :py:func:`str` and :py:func:`verify` functions, | ||
the modules implementing named password hashing constructs expose also | ||
a :py:func:`kdf` function returning a raw pseudo-random bytes sequence | ||
derived from the input parameters | ||

nacl.pwhash.argon2id | ||
"""""""""""""""""""" | ||
|
||
.. module:: nacl.pwhash.argon2id | ||
|
||
.. function:: kdf(size, password, salt, \ | ||
opslimit=OPSLIMIT_SENSITIVE, \ | ||
memlimit=MEMLIMIT_SENSITIVE, \ | ||
encoder=nacl.encoding.RawEncoder) | ||
|
||
Derive a ``size`` bytes long key from a caller-supplied | ||
``password`` and ``salt`` pair using the ``argon2id`` partially | ||
data dependent memory-hard construct. | ||
|
||
:param size: derived key size, must be between | ||
:py:const:`BYTES_MIN` and | ||
:py:const:`BYTES_MAX` | ||
:type size: int | ||
:param password: password used to seed the key derivation procedure; | ||
it length must be between | ||
:py:const:`PASSWD_MIN` and | ||
:py:const:`PASSWD_MAX` | ||
:type password: bytes | ||
:param salt: **RANDOM** salt used in the key derivation procedure; | ||
its length must be exactly :py:const:`.SALTBYTES` | ||
:type salt: bytes | ||
:param opslimit: the time component (operation count) | ||
of the key derivation procedure's computational cost; | ||
it must be between | ||
:py:const:`OPSLIMIT_MIN` and | ||
:py:const:`OPSLIMIT_MAX` | ||
:type opslimit: int | ||
:param memlimit: the memory occupation component | ||
of the key derivation procedure's computational cost; | ||
it must be between | ||
:py:const:`MEMLIMIT_MIN` and | ||
:py:const:`MEMLIMIT_MAX` | ||
:type memlimit: int | ||
:rtype: bytes | ||
|
||
The default settings for opslimit and memlimit are those deemed | ||
correct for generating a key, which can be used to protect | ||
sensitive data for a long time, leading to a multi-second | ||
hashing time. | ||
|
||
.. versionadded:: 1.2 | ||
|
||
.. function:: str(password, \ | ||
opslimit=OPSLIMIT_INTERACTIVE, \ | ||
memlimit=MEMLIMIT_INTERACTIVE) | ||
|
||
Returns a password verifier hash, generated with the ``argon2id`` | ||
password hasher. | ||
|
||
See: :py:func:`nacl.pwhash.str` for the general API. | ||
|
||
.. versionadded:: 1.2 | ||
|
||
.. function:: verify(password_hash, password) | ||
|
||
This function verifies the proposed ``password``, using | ||
``password_hash`` as a password verifier. | ||
|
||
See: :py:func:`nacl.pwhash.verify` for the general API. | ||
|
||
.. versionadded:: 1.2 | ||
|
||
|
||
.. rubric:: Module level constants | ||
|
||
The module defines the constants related to the :py:func:`kdf` raw hashing | ||
construct | ||
|
||
.. py:data:: SALTBYTES | ||
the length of the random bytes sequence passed in as a salt to the | ||
:py:func:`kdf` | ||
|
||
.. py:data:: BYTES_MIN | ||
.. py:data:: BYTES_MAX | ||
the minimum and maximum allowed values for the ``size`` parameter | ||
of the :py:func:`kdf` | ||
|
||
|
||
The meaning of each of the constants | ||
|
||
.. py:data:: PASSWD_MIN | ||
.. py:data:: PASSWD_MAX | ||
.. py:data:: PWHASH_SIZE | ||
.. py:data:: OPSLIMIT_MIN | ||
.. py:data:: OPSLIMIT_MAX | ||
.. py:data:: MEMLIMIT_MIN | ||
.. py:data:: MEMLIMIT_MAX | ||
.. py:data:: MEMLIMIT_INTERACTIVE | ||
.. py:data:: OPSLIMIT_INTERACTIVE | ||
.. py:data:: MEMLIMIT_SENSITIVE | ||
.. py:data:: OPSLIMIT_SENSITIVE | ||
.. py:data:: MEMLIMIT_MODERATE | ||
.. py:data:: OPSLIMIT_MODERATE | ||
is the same as in :py:mod:`nacl.hash`. | ||
